BASH/CLI

Category: Creating and using FOSS
Published on Friday, 29 May 2015 21:49
Written by Super User
Hits: 8618

BASH shell, shell scripting

shell scripting
shell commands
terminal emulator

Shell scripting
BASH/shell cheat sheet | OverAPI.com
Shell Scripting Tutorial | Tutorialspoint 6 Best Online Linux Bash Editors
Top 3 Online Resources For Learning The Command Line 4 Free Shell Scripting eBooks for Linux Newbies and Administrators
Five Cool Alternative Open Source Linux Shells - LinuxAndUbuntu Top 5 Linux Shells You Should Know About
3 Ways to Change a User Default Shell in Linux  
A Beginner's Guide to the Linux Command Line - TechSpot A Beginner's Guide to the Linux Command Line, Part II - TechSpot
Linux Shell Scripting Tutorial - A Beginner's handbook  
11 Linux command line guides you shouldn't be without Linux Shell Tips - The Best Linux Command Line Web Portal
LinuxCommand.org: Learn the Linux command line. Write shell scripts HakTip: Linux Terminal - Getting Started!
How to Install and Use ZSH Shell in Linux A User's Guide to the Z-Shell
XONSH(pronounced “Konk“)is a Python-powered shell xonsh - Replit IDE
Bash Guide for Beginners Free Guide Incomplete Path Expansion (Completion) For Bash
Bash Globbing Tutorial An introduction to pipes and named pipes in Linux
Bash command line exit codes demystified Introduction to Linux IO, Standard Streams, and Redirection
How to define and use functions in Linux Shell Script Heading in the Right (Re)Direction
Using the Bash case Statement in Shell Scripting read Command in Linux with Examples
Bash Script: Flags usage with arguments examples Bash script: Pause script before proceeding
Introduction to /dev/null A.K.A. The Bit Bucket Silencing the Noise: A Guide to Redirecting Output to /dev/null in Linux
Introduction to Bash Shell Parameter Expansions How to Store or Assign a Linux command in a Variable in Bash Shell Script
Bash bang commands: A must-know trick for the Linux command line Bash Lists of Commands – Using Control Operators
10 Amazing and Mysterious Uses of (!) Symbol or Operator in Linux Commands Bash Scripting – Associative Array Explained With Examples
25 Linux Shell Scripting interview Questions & Answers Use Bash Scripting to Enhance Your Productivity
How to Create Your Own Commands in Linux Create and use aliases
30 Handy Bash Shell Aliases For Linux / Unix / Mac OS X 15 command-line aliases to save you time
Using Command Line Aliases – Frequently | Freedom Penguin A Shell Primer: Master Your Linux, OS X, Unix Shell Environment
unix_linux_introduction.pdf Command Line Arguments in Linux Shell Scripting
Command-line-fu How to run multiple commands in Linux Simultaneously
How to manage your Linux command history McFly – A Replacement To ‘Ctrl+R’ Bash History Search Feature
How to manage Bash history How to create a Bash completion script
How to run Linux commands simultaneously with GNU Parallel Here documents in bash explained
Gogo – Create Shortcuts to Long and Complicated Paths in Linux Developing Console Applications with Bash
Zenity Manual Zenity - GUI for Shell Scripts
How To Create GUI Dialog Boxes In Bash Scripts With Zenity In Linux And Unix Gtkdialog – Create Graphical (GTK+) Interfaces and Dialog Boxes Using Shell Scripts in Linux
GNU bash manual Bash Reference Manual
BASH Programming - Introduction HOW-TO Advanced Bash-Scripting Guide
Linux Shell Scripting Tutorial (LSST) v2.0 Steve's Bourne / Bash shell scripting tutorial
Debugging Shell Scripts in Linux Getting Started with BASH
How to Replace Bash with Python as Your Go-To Command Line Language Bash-it – Bash Framework to Control Your Scripts and Aliases
.bashrc vs .bash_profile How to repeat a Linux command until it succeeds
All about {Curly Braces} in Bash Bash Scripting – Variables Explained With Examples
How to Create a Multiple Choice Menu in Bash Scripts Put a Timer on Your Running Commands With Timeout Command in Linux
How to Use the xargs Command in Linux How to Use the Powerful Xargs Command in Linux [Explained with Examples]
curl - Tutorialspoint Basics of HTTP Requests with cURL: An In-Depth Tutorial
Unix Shells: Bash, Fish, Ksh, Tcsh, Zsh What's your favorite shell for sysadmin work?
How to use indexed arrays in bash How to Use echo Command in Bash Scripts in Linux
Test Your BASH Skills By Playing Command Line Games What Does ‐‐ (double dash) Mean In SSH Shell Command?
Adding arguments and options to your Bash scripts 12 Best Practices for Writing Bash Scripts
How To Parse CSV Files In Bash Scripts In Linux How To Create GUI Dialog Boxes In Bash Scripts With Whiptail In Linux
How To Debug Bash Scripts In Linux And Unix How To Perform Arithmetic Operations In Bash
How to Use Bash For Loop in Linux Stacking Directories With “pushd” and “popd” Commands for Easy Navigation

 

Top

Shell commands
5 Linux command line classes from Coursera
Linux Cheat Sheets for Quick Access from the Command Line
Navi – An Interactive Commandline Cheatsheet Tool
How To Display Linux Commands Cheatsheets Using Eg
An A-Z Index of the Bash command line for Linux.
The Best Modern Linux Commands For Beginners And Experts - alternative utilities
Modern Alternatives to Some of the Classic Linux Commands
How to Easily Remember Linux Commands
7 ways to remember Linux commands
How to Backup and Restore Linux Terminal History
Linux Command Directory: Index
Linux Commands - Overview and Examples
Thirteen Useful Tools for Working with Text on the Command Line
Trash-CLI Command Line Recycle Bin - Never Lose Another File
Essential Unix utilities
Betty – A Friendly Interface For Your Linux Command Line
How to Easily Read a Linux Man Page
How to use a man page: Faster than a Google search
Learn To Use Man Pages Efficiently
How To View A Specific Section In Man Pages In Linux
3 Good Alternatives To Man Pages Every Linux User Should Know
TLDR Pages - A Simplified alternative to Unix/Linux man pages
Search, Study And Practice Linux Commands On The Fly Using Tldr++
Display Linux Commands Cheatsheets With Tealdeer Tool
Man Pages | Mankier
explainshell.com - match command-line arguments to their help text
Understanding Shell Commands Easily Using "Explain Shell" Script in Linux
ExplainShell – Find What Each Part Of A Linux Command does
The Bash Shell Startup Files
Customizing the Bash shell
Linux Shell Scripting Tutorial v1.05r3 A Beginner's handbook
The Best Keyboard Shortcuts for Bash (aka the Linux and macOS Terminal)
Useful Linux Command Line Bash Shortcuts You Should Know
Change shell properties with Linux shopt command
Empower Linux Command Line With Screen Capturing Capability Through Scrot - MyLinuxBook | MyLinuxBook
The powerful bash wildcards – 2.0 | JUST NOBODY

 

Top

Terminal emulator
Difference Between a Terminal, Shell, TTY, and Console
Top 10 Terminal Emulators for Linux (With Extra Features or Amazing Looks)
8 Best Online Linux Terminals and Distributions
Linux Shells: Bash, Zsh, and Fish Explained
23 Best Terminal Emulators for Linux Desktop in 2023
Best Online Linux Terminals and Online Bash Editors
Virtual console
What is a Linux Virtual Console?
Linux / UNIX: Virtual consoles (VC)
Killing a Hung Virtual Console
Survey: Console Based Linux File Managers
RNR Is A Terminal File Manager That Combines Features From Midnight Commander and Ranger
Introduction to Ranger file manager
The Terminal Is Where Linux Begins - and Where You Should, Too
How to Record Linux Terminal Sessions
How to replay terminal sessions recorded with the Linux script command
My top 10 terminal shortcuts for Linux
179 Color Schemes For Your Gtk-Based Linux Terminal (Gnome Terminal, Tilix, Xfce Terminal, More)
Select Colors in Terminal with RGB-TUI
Who needs a GUI? How to live in a Linux terminal. | Network World
30 days in a terminal: Day 1 — The essentials
4 cool terminal multiplexers
Lash#Cat9: A radical new Linux UI for keyboard warriors
10 Beautiful Fonts for Your Linux Terminal
 
An introduction to GNU Screen
Screen Command Examples To Manage Multiple Terminal Sessions
GNU Screen quick reference
How To Autostart Screen Session On Linux When Logging In
 
How to Use ‘Tmux Terminal’ to Access Multiple Terminals Inside a Single Console
5 Useful Tips for Better Tmux Terminal Sessions
Tmux Command Examples To Manage Multiple Terminal Sessions
Autostart Tmux Session On Remote System When Logging In Via SSH
Use this cheat sheet for tmux as a terminal multiplexer
Enhancing SSH Login With A Tmux Session Selection Menu In Linux
How To Save And Restore Tmux Environments Across Reboots In Linux
 
Tilda – A Highly Configurable GTK Based Drop Down Terminal For Unix-like Systems
6 Excellent Console Linux File Managers - Linux Links - The Linux Portal Site
7 Best Command Line Navigation Tools - Linux Links - The Linux Portal Site
10 Best Free Linux Terminal Recorders - Linux Links - The Linux Portal Site
6 Alternative Linux Shells for Power Users
jm-shell – A Highly Informative and Customized Bash Shell
Top 7 terminal emulators for Linux | Opensource.com
5 Highly Promising Terminal Emulators
3 Best GPU-Accelerated Terminal Emulators for Linux
Kitty – The Fast, Feature-Rich, GPU-Based Terminal Emulator
3 Unique Takes on the Linux Terminal at Your Command | Linux.com | The source for Linux information
 
GNOME Terminal
GNOME Terminal User's Guide
Replace the Linux GNOME Terminal with the Terminator | LinuxBSDos.com
Terminator – A Terminal Emulator to Manage Multiple Terminal Windows on Linux
Terminator: The Tiling Terminal Emulator for Linux Pros
 
Guake 0.7.0 Released - A Drop-Down Terminal for Gnome Desktops
Guake Terminal: A Customizable Linux Terminal for Power Users [Inspired by an FPS Game]
 
Fish - A Smart and User-Friendly Interactive Shell for Linux
Simplify the Linux Command Line with Fish Shell
fish shell
fish-shell documentation
friendly interactive shell - Wikipedia
Tutorial | fish-shell
How To Install, Configure And Use Fish Shell In Linux?
How to Install Fish Shell (with Starship) in Linux
 
Upgrade Your Linux Terminal with Tilix
Tilix brings powerful terminal emulation to Fedora
Tilix: Advanced Tiling Terminal Emulator for Power Users
Tilix: Documentation
How to Install and Use Tilix Terminal Emulator in Linux
 
Terminus – A Web Technology Based Modern Terminal
Hyper – A Beautiful Terminal Built With HTML, CSS And JavaScript
Get A Terminal Embedded In Nautilus File Manager With Nautilus Terminal 3
vtm Is A Text-Based Desktop Environment That Runs Inside A Terminal

 

Top